Sapiens and Neanderthals coexisted in prehistoric Israel, rare cave burials show
Times of Israel ^ | 11 March 2025 | Rossella Tercatin

Posted on 03/11/2025 9:56:47 AM PDT by Fractal Trader

Some 100,000 years ago, a group of hominins shared hunting strategies, tool manufacturing tips and how to honor the dead, performing complex and highly symbolic rituals, according to a recent analysis of rare findings from Israel’s Tinshemet Cave.

Located in central Israel, near Shoham, the Tinshemet Cave was active for millennia during the period known as Middle Paleolithic, 130,000 to 80,000 years ago. The findings include the first complete prehistoric human skeletons uncovered in Israel since the 1960s, which researchers say are among the best preserved in the world.

“This is one of the most interesting sites for Paleolithic research and human evolution in Israel,” Prof. Yossi Zaidner of the Hebrew University of Jerusalem, told The Times of Israel in a phone interview in conjunction with the publication of an academic paper on Tuesday. “It sheds light on an incredibly rich culture of symbolic and ritual behaviors, especially in connection with burials.”

While researchers have yet to determine what type of hominins are buried in the caves, the site has already provided unique insights into their social life in prehistoric Israel.

“If we consider this cave in conjunction with other Middle Paleolithic sites in our region, we get to an unprecedented understanding of how different hominins interacted,” Zaidner said.

The cave presented a wealth of ochre, fauna, and stone tools, which offer important hints at how its inhabitants lived and died.
